Install claude-cobrain daemon and start it with python3 directly.
Infer language from the user's message. If there is no context, default to English.
Find the plugin root directory. The plugin root directory is most likely in <USER_ROOT>/.claude/plugins/.
Required source files:
<CLAUDE_PLUGIN_ROOT>/scripts/cobrain.py - daemon script to copy<CLAUDE_PLUGIN_ROOT>/scripts/control.sh - process controller scriptMinimize user approval prompts: chain independent shell commands with && into single Bash calls.
~/.claude/cobrainOUTPUT_DIR.Run all checks in a single command:
command -v python3 && python3 --version && \
command -v ollama && ollama --version && \
python3 -c "import PIL, ollama; print('ok')" && \
ollama list | grep qwen3-vl
If success: skip installation steps.
If failure: install only missing prerequisites.
